The Connection Between Eco-Friendly Textiles and Skin Health
Eco-friendly textiles are fabrics produced using environmentally responsible methods that prioritize sustainability and safety. Among these, organic cotton stands out because of its natural cultivation process, which avoids synthetic pesticides, fertilizers, and harmful chemicals. This reduces the chemical load on the fabric and, consequently, on your skin.
For individuals with sensitive skin, contact with residues from chemical treatments often causes irritation, rashes, or allergic reactions. According to the American Academy of Dermatology, approximately 10-20% of dermatological cases are related to textile allergies or irritant dermatitis. Using eco-friendly textiles like GOTS-certified organic cotton can dramatically reduce these risks because they are designed to be chemical-free from seed to sewn (source).
Why Most "Organic" Fabrics Fail to Solve Skin Irritation
Despite the label "organic," many fabrics claiming to be organic fall short of truly preventing skin irritation. The reasons for this are multifaceted:
1. Certification Fraud and Greenwashing
Many manufacturers utilize vague claims or minimal certifications that do not guarantee comprehensive chemical safety. Some products are only partially processed with organic materials, while others are heavily treated with dyes, finishing agents, or preservatives that cause skin reactions.
2. Partial Processing and Non-Compliance
Some "organic" fabrics undergo chemical treatments post-harvest, such as bleaching or synthetic dyeing, which can introduce irritants. Without strict oversight or certification, these fabrics may contain residues harmful to sensitive skin.
3. Lack of Regulatory Standards
In many regions, regulations are inconsistent or lax, allowing inferior or partially organic fabrics to appear as premium products misleadingly. This deception undermines consumer trust and compromises skin safety.
How GOTS Certification Ensures Complete Chemical-Free Safety
The GOTS certification is recognized worldwide as the ultimate standard for organic textiles. It sets strict criteria that cover every aspect of textile production—from farming to finishing—ensuring the fabric is free from harmful chemicals and safe for sensitive skin.
Key GOTS Requirements:
- No use of prohibited chemicals: Pesticides, heavy metals, formaldehyde, or synthetic dyes are banned.
- Strict Processing Standards: All processing agents, dyes, and treatments must be non-toxic and biodegradable.
- Social and Environmental Criteria: Ethical labor practices and environmental sustainability are mandated.
- Traceability: Every stage, from harvesting organic cotton to final product, is documented and verified.
This comprehensive approach guarantees that GOTS-certified organic cotton fabrics are 100% free from residual chemicals that could irritate delicate skin, making them an ideal choice for babies, allergy-prone individuals, or anyone seeking natural comfort.
Feel and Comfort: Ring-Spun Versus Conventional Cotton
When choosing fabrics for sensitive skin, the tactile experience matters. Two common types of cotton fabric production are ring-spun and conventional spun cotton.
Ring-Spun Cotton
- Texture: Typically softer, finer, and more durable.
- Feel: Smooth and gentle on the skin, reducing scratchiness.
- Suitability: Excellent for sensitive skin and high-quality clothing that lasts longer.
Conventional Cotton
- Texture: Usually coarser and rougher.
- Feel: Might cause irritation or discomfort, especially over extended wear.
- Suitability: More common in low-cost or mass-produced textiles that may contain residual chemicals or rough fibers.
For sensitive skin, ring-spun cotton is often the preferred choice because its softer, smoother surface minimizes friction and irritation. It also indicates better fiber quality, which is crucial when seeking organically grown, chemical-free textiles.
Addressing Concerns About Fabric "Specks" in Organic Cotton
Some consumers worry about the presence of tiny specks or fibers in organic cotton fabrics, suspecting they may be residual pesticides or manufacturing debris. However, these specks are often a natural part of fiber processing.
Natural Fiber Imperfections:
- Organic cotton fibers can contain small leaf particles or seed fragments, especially if minimally processed.
- Proper milling and finishing techniques remove most impurities, resulting in a cleaner fabric.
- When buying GOTS-certified organic cotton, these imperfections are minimized because strict processing standards are enforced.
Why It Matters:
- These specks are harmless and do not indicate chemical contamination.
- They are a sign of natural, minimally treated fibers aligned with organic principles.
- Ensuring proper washing before use will further reduce any residual natural debris.
